Output 663efce81e09341e10d295301f551c457ef1e58dc676e70694c35479c15e2acc:5
- value
- 21488131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8476cb64e37616ce04c075b83f64c867d900b52f OP_EQUAL
- address
- 3DmRRrQ4fLyszVyLaPjDqMZuASwmkdxxTW
- transaction
- 663efce81e09341e10d295301f551c457ef1e58dc676e70694c35479c15e2acc
- spent
- true